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A) and Family Nurse Practitioner Programs will pay a stipend over $2,300.00 and full tuition towards obtaining a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ist or Family Nurse Practitioner MSN with prescriptive privileges. See instructions for completing HPSP agreements (https://dcp.psc.gov/ccmis/PDF_docs/2019%20HPSP%20Agreement%20Instructions.pdf), The effective date of the agreement is the date the officer becomes eligible for HPSP, provided the completed agreement is signed within 30 days of becoming eligible and the agreement is received by CCHQ within 60 days of becoming eligible; the date the completed agreement is signed, if received by CCHQ within 60 days of the date of becoming initially eligible for HPSP but signed more than 30 days after becoming initially eligible; the date the completed agreement is received by CCHQ, if received more than 60 days after the date of becoming initially eligible; or any later date. * Time spent in a military residency or fellowship program does not count towards service obligation. It is the officers responsibility to be familiar with the published policies that apply to all USPHS Commissioned Corps officers and maintain an ongoing awareness of updates and changes to USPHS Commissioned Corps policies, including any periodic changes to the HPSP policy, pay rates, and/or eligibility requirements; An officer must maintain current and updated contact information (e.g., e-mail, phone, address) in CCHQ in order to facilitate the USPHS Commissioned Corps communication of information to the office; It is the officers responsibility to initiate and/or renew an agreement when appropriate and to ensure data is correct to support their eligibility for HPSP.
